I had one of the best, freshest, artful Hawaiian meals at the Roots Cafe. The menu changes daily (only opened Tuesdays and Thursday 11:30-1:30) and the food is all locally sourced. Prices are under $10.Roots Cafe is a teaching cafe within the Kokua Kalihi Valley Health Center. The food is prepared by students! Today, I ordered the eggplant sandwich which came on a large flatbread. The eggplant was soft and flavorful topped with tomatoes and avocado. The salad on the side artfully topped with edible flower petals and composed of tender lettuce and micro greens. Excellent and filling! Don't miss the deserts! The starfruit upside down cake was moist and delicious. Deserts change daily as well. Food is carry out but there a couple tables within the Health Center. I'm going back.

We went on a bus adventure to check out Roots Cafe at 2229 N School Street as I had been following them on Instagram for quite some time. They do so much for the Kalihi community to connect the people to the land, sea, culture, community, and family by providing local, fresh produce and healthy, accessible meals in a place that promotes wellness, sharing and togetherness.We had two ono, healthy meals (wahoo/ono greens bowl, fish sandwich w/ kalo fries, lemongrass tea). Check out their Instagram for menus of their fresh produce and meals available every Tuesday and Thursday from 11AM to 1:30PM. Produce is available to EBT customers at 50% off.
